GOSHEN - Kim Marie Hershberger, 54, was found dead at her Goshen home June 11. In her life, she transcended suffering to find a rare and wonderful joy.. Kim was born July 25, 1959, with her identical twin, Gay, to Theodore and Marilyn Grindle. Kim and Gay were two of five Grindle girls of Syracuse, along with Debra and another set of identical twins, Jan and Jill.. When Gay died in a car crash in 1981, Kim despaired. She knew her twin had found peace, but the loss would haunt her for years to come.. In 1981, Kim married W. Mark Hershberger. They had two children, Andrew in 1982 and Sara in 1984. Andrew and Sara grew up in a loving, supportive home, but Kim battled inner demons. She fought substance abuse and her marriage ended after 13 years. In 1995, she had a beloved daughter, Sasha Byrd.. In 2005, Kim developed cervical dystonia and sciatica. She was treated with expert care, but she faced a life of ever-increasing pain and immobility.. In her suffering, she found perspective. She quit drinking and committed herself to appreciating life and the people she loved.. She found joy in her favorite things: a skein of yarn to crochet with, a public radio program, a sunny day. She made friends across the world on the Internet.. She was overjoyed to attend the weddings of two of her children: Andrew to Leah Plank in July 2012 and Sara to Ryan Warnke in May 2014. In January 2014, Sasha gave her a grandson, Josiah.. Kim died unexpectedly, but she lived every day joyfully as though it would be her last.. Cremation has taken place at Yoder-Culp Funeral Home in Goshen.. A celebration of life will be held at 6 p.m. Saturday, June 28 at First United Methodist Church in Goshen.
